A study [ 39 ] investigated the positive rate of PRRSV in South China from 2017 to 2021 and found that the detection rate of PRRSV in South China showed an increasing trend year by year from 2017 to 2021, and PRRSV in South China was still dominated by highly pathogenic strains, which was consistent with the clinical test results in our study.
